RCPD Report: 4/18/23

0
By KMAN Staff on April 18, 2023 RCPD Reports

Officers filed a report for theft in the 1200 block of Hylton Heights in Manhattan on April 17, 2023, around 8:00 a.m. Kindercare was listed as the victim when it was reported six tricycles from a fenced-in play area were stolen over the weekend. Three of the tricycles were recovered in a nearby area. The estimated total loss associated with this case is approximately $1,450. Anyone with information can contact Crime Stoppers. Using Crime Stoppers allows you to remain anonymous and could qualify you for a cash reward of up to $1,000.

Officers filed a report for theft in the 1800 block of Platt St. in Manhattan on April 17, 2023, around 10:15 a.m. A 22-year-old man was listed as the victim when it was reported his grey 2008 Volvo XC70 was stolen overnight. The estimated total loss associated with this case is approximately $25,000. Anyone with information can contact Crime Stoppers. Using Crime Stoppers allows you to remain anonymous and could qualify you for a cash reward of up to $1,000.

Officers filed a report for theft in the 1800 block of Platt St. in Manhattan on April 17, 2023, around 12:00 p.m. A 20-year-old woman was listed as the victim when it was reported her car was broken into overnight and her Kate Spade purse and miscellaneous clothes were stolen from inside. The estimated total loss associated with this case is approximately $500. Anyone with information can contact Crime Stoppers. Using Crime Stoppers allows you to remain anonymous and could qualify you for a cash reward of up to $1,000.

Daniel Weaver, 36, was arrested on April 17, 2023, around 9:45 a.m. while already confined in the Riley County Jail for battery on LEO after spitting in the face of a 35-year-old Corrections Officer. Weaver was issued a bond of $15,000 for this arrest and remains confined in the Riley County Jail.
